Abstract
Japan’s rapidly aging population necessitates new approaches that enable citizens to actively participate in caring for themselves and others. However, a comprehensive framework defining the specific competencies needed for this critical community role has not yet been established. This study, therefore, aimed to define the novel concept of “care competency” and establish a consensus on its comprehensive component list for community citizens. We defined care competencies and developed a list using a modified Delphi technique (RAND/University of California, Los Angeles) involving 10 nursing researchers. Items were adapted from Japan’s Model Core Curriculum for Nursing Education, and a total of 528 items were evaluated and refined. In this study, care competency was defined as the complex ability to acquire and utilize knowledge and skills, based on evidence and intentional choices, to maintain the well-being of oneself, loved ones, and people in the community. The Delphi process identified 151 care competency items. This study thereby presents a novel framework that provides a foundation for developing globally applicable educational programs to foster mutual support and effective caregiving.
1. Introduction
Community-based care models are crucial in rapidly aging societies globally, and the need for integrated care approaches is vital for safeguarding the well-being of citizens in our communities [,]. Japan has one of the fastest-aging populations in the world, and with the proportion of people aged 65 and over projected to reach 38.7% by 2070 [], community-based care models are indispensable. In these models, citizens—including family members and neighbors—are encouraged to assume an important role in providing care []. To effectively fulfill their roles in a community-based, inclusive society, each community member is expected to acquire the necessary knowledge and skills related to caring for themselves and others through education and training.
Effective education and training require a well-grounded theoretical basis and a conceptual model. Existing concepts related to the acquisition of knowledge and skills in caring for themselves and others include health literacy [,,], community literacy [], and care literacy []. Health literacy, a concept related to the acquisition of knowledge and skills in caring for oneself and others, refers to the degree to which individuals can obtain, process, and understand the basic health information and services needed to make appropriate health decisions [,,]. However, a critical gap in existing frameworks is that they focus mainly on understanding and lack the practical dimensions of caregiving, such as empathic attitudes, role readiness, and contextual decision-making—skills that are crucial for non-professionals. Consequently, they do not fully capture the complex ability to integrate and apply knowledge, attitudes, and practical skills in real-world scenarios. To address this critical gap and enhance training programs, we propose the novel and comprehensive concept of “care competency.”
Care competency is defined as the complex ability to acquire and utilize knowledge and skills, based on evidence and intentional choices, to maintain the well-being of oneself, loved ones, and the community. We labeled this concept “care competency” because it includes knowledge and literacy as well as the skills and ability to implement them in practice. Currently, programs are being implemented to equip various citizens with the knowledge and skills required for caregiving [,,]. In Japan, numerous specific “care training programs” have been established, such as dementia supporter [] and mental health peer supporter [] training programs. While many programs focus on specific diseases or caregiving techniques, none are based on a comprehensive competency framework. Therefore, comprehensive programs based on a framework that addresses the necessary knowledge, attitudes, and skills required to provide and receive care are needed.
Thus, this study aimed to clarify the concept and components of care competencies based on expert consensus using the Delphi method, a structured technique that allows for the systematic evaluation and selection of conceptual items.
2. Materials and Methods
2.1. Study Design
This study comprised two phases as follows: (1) defining care competencies, and (2) conducting two expert rating rounds using the RAND/University of California, Los Angeles (UCLA) method, an approach jointly developed by the RAND Corporation and UCLA []. The RAND/UCLA (modified Delphi) method was selected as the most appropriate consensus group method as it allows for beginning with selected items grounded in previous work [].
We used the Model Core Curriculum for Nursing Education in Japan [] as the initial definition of the competencies required for community citizens. We then used a modified Delphi approach (the RAND/UCLA method) over two rating rounds with stakeholders to assess and select items from the Model Core Curriculum for community citizens who are non-healthcare professionals. The RAND/UCLA method provides a systematic approach to evaluating each item by combining quantitative ratings and qualitative discussions. Each item was independently rated on a 9-point scale for its importance, followed by statistical analysis of the median and interquartile ranges to identify the level of agreement. Where there was disagreement over individual items, these were reviewed and discussed in panel meetings to reach a consensus, ensuring that the final selection reflected both empirical assessment and expert judgment. In setting the criteria for agreement and disagreement, we referred to the RAND/UCLA Appropriateness Method User’s Manual (pp. 59–63), which defines the thresholds for panel sizes of 8–9 members. Although our panel consisted of 10 members and did not exactly match the 9-member model, we adopted comparable criteria to maintain consistency with the RAND/UCLA framework and ensure a structured, evidence-based consensus process [].
2.2. Panelists
The panelists in this study comprised 10 nursing researchers, all holding nursing credentials in Japan. This diverse group of nursing professionals had various areas of expertise, ensuring a wide range of perspectives on care competencies. As the study used the Model Core Curriculum for Nursing Education in Japan as its starting point, the selection criteria specifically required that all panelists hold a registered nurse license, and nine members also possessed a Public Health Nurse qualification. Together, the panelists’ expertise covered all competency domains, including community, acute care, geriatric, home visiting, public health, and pediatric nursing. They were recruited through an opportunistic call for research collaboration, with each individual volunteering to participate. A key selection criterion was prior working experience as a nurse or public health nurse in either clinical (hospital) or administrative settings.
2.3. Defining Care Competencies and List Development
The process commenced with an in-depth discussion among the researchers, who collaboratively reviewed the existing literature to establish a definition of care competency. We examined textbooks from elementary, junior high, and high schools, alongside the citizen education programs implemented by companies and local governments, to determine how they align with the Model Core Curriculum of Nursing Education. This analysis facilitated the identification of trends within the current content of education and training. This step was especially crucial for clearly understanding the skills, knowledge, and attitudes essential for community members who are non-healthcare professionals.
The Model Core Curriculum for Nursing Education in Japan [] outlines the foundational knowledge and skills that nursing professionals are expected to acquire during their basic education. We selected this rigorous professional curriculum because it provides a comprehensive structure encompassing the necessary knowledge, attitudes, and practical skills essential for safeguarding health and well-being, as compared with existing non-professional training programs that usually lack a comprehensive theoretical basis and the integration of attitudes and practical skills. Given that the nursing profession’s training program curriculum includes essential elements for comprehensive professional development, it serves as an appropriate and robust basis for systematically developing care competencies tailored to community members who are non-healthcare professionals. We pooled 528 items from the curriculum for further analysis.
2.4. Delphi Surveys Using the RAND/UCLA Method
We conducted a two-round rating process between November 2022 and June 2023. In each round, the core elements of each item were rated on a 9-point Likert scale from 1 (“not essential”) to 9 (“essential”) [], and the results were analyzed to identify any disagreements. Statistical analyses were conducted by two researchers who were not part of the 10-person expert panel (MT and TY) to ensure the integrity of the Delphi process. Their responsibilities included calculating the median ratings, interquartile ranges, and levels of agreement for each item, as well as moderating the panel meetings. Access to each other’s ratings was restricted throughout the rating period to minimize potential bias among the panelists. Each panelist then independently reviewed the competencies and assigned scores. At this phase, panelists were allowed to view aggregated scoring data and statistical information—such as median ratings and the number of raters for each score—during the panel meetings. Although the panelists’ scores were disclosed, the identities of the individuals who provided each score remained anonymous. This approach ensured that the ratings were not influenced by the status or perceived authority of any individual rater.
2.4.1. First Evaluation
During the initial evaluation phase (1 week in April 2023), the researchers (MT and TY) implemented a comprehensive scoring system to rate each item on the 9-point scale (1 = “not essential” to 9 = “essential”) []. Each panelist independently reviewed the competencies and assigned scores based on their understanding of how necessary each item was for the care competencies of community citizens. The 10 panelists emailed the completed spreadsheets to the researchers after entering their scores.
2.4.2. Panel Meeting
Panel meetings were held between the first and second evaluation rounds. During this meeting, each panelist was encouraged to discuss their reasoning behind the scores they assigned. Based on the RAND/UCLA method, we selected items with a median score of ≥7, for which at least three panelists scored between 1 and 6, or those with a median score of ≤3, for which at least three panelists scored between 4 and 9 []. Items that were clearly deemed appropriate for deletion were eliminated at the panel meeting if all panelists approved. This dialog fostered a collaborative environment where the panelists reached a consensus on the perceived value of each care competency item, ensuring that the final assessments reflected a collective agreement on their importance in the context of the care competencies of community members who are non-healthcare professionals. The median scores and number of panel members assigning ratings from 1 to 9 were calculated using Microsoft Excel.
2.4.3. Second Evaluation
The 10 panelists repeated the scoring process for the second evaluation using the criteria established in the first evaluation. Each item was reevaluated, and the median score for each competency was calculated to gauge its overall importance. Items that received a median score of ≥7, for which two or fewer panelists scored between 1 and 6, indicating they were deemed essential, were retained. This rigorous evaluation process ensured that only the most essential care competencies were included in the final framework.
2.4.4. Final Version of the Competencies
The final refinement of the care competency list was conducted after the modified Delphi study’s second evaluation round. This step aimed to clarify the items on the list by allowing panelists to discuss merging similar items with others identified in the second evaluation, as illustrated in Appendix A (Figure A1). The refinement process began with 227 essential items, some of which were then merged to ensure clarity regarding the elements included in the concept of care competencies. Ultimately, this refinement resulted in a final list of 151 competency items, which received unanimous approval from all panelists. Based on this procedure, the researchers aimed to establish a comprehensive list of care competencies that could inform educational programs for community members.
3. Results
3.1. Defining Care Competencies
We began by closely examining current health and care concepts to identify essential terms to include in our definition of care competency. Each researcher subsequently developed individual draft definitions of care competency based on these key terms. Through collaborative review and discussion, we reached a consensus to establish the final definition.
“Care competency” was defined as the “multidimensional ability to acquire and consciously utilize evidence-based knowledge and skills to sustain the life, health, and well-being of oneself, one’s family and friends, and people in the community. This ability encompasses a respectful attitude toward human dignity; an understanding of physical, psychological, and social health and well-being; and practical skills in care-related communication and actions.”
3.2. Delphi Surveys

3.2.1. Panelists
All 10 invited panel members (9 women, 1 man) participated in the two Delphi rounds. Each panelist held registered nurse qualifications, with an average of 12.8 years of experience as researchers.
3.2.2. First Evaluation
The first evaluation comprised 528 items. None of the items had a median of 1–3; 79 had a median of 4–6, and 415 had a median of 7–9, of which 128 had at least three panelists with a median of 1–6. Among the 528 items, 204 met the panel-meeting criteria.
3.2.3. Panel Meeting
The panelists shared how they scored the items. For example, for “Ability to judge the effects and side effects of treatments such as pharmacotherapy,” they commented, “I rated it lower since I thought the verb ‘judge’ might be beyond the ability expected of non-professional people”, and “I rated it lower; the phase of being able to judge is quite advanced.” The panel discussion revealed that during the evaluation, the influence of the verbs in the items overshadowed their actual content. Therefore, we removed the verbs from each item and revised them to focus on evaluating their content for the second scoring round. After the panel meeting, the panelists deleted 57 items from the second evaluation. These items had median points < 4, and their deletion was unanimously agreed upon during a panel meeting.
3.2.4. Second Evaluation
The Second Evaluation began with 471 items. In total, 227 items were deemed essential (median of 7–9) with two or fewer disagreements (scored 1–3 by each panelist) for inclusion in the final framework.
3.2.5. Final Version of the Competencies
Since we planned to create educational programs, the 227 items were refined by merging similar items to clarify the elements included in the concept of care competencies. This resulted in a final list of four themes encompassing 23 domains and 151 items that received consensus from all panelists. Table 1 and Appendix B (Figure A2, Table A1 and Table A2) list the care competencies and core components.

Overview of care competencies.
The four themes were: foundations of care competency, care competency across the lifespan, care competency by stages of illness, and care competency through living in the community. The first, foundations of care competency, includes 76 items covering essential knowledge, attitudes, and skills such as health basics (nutrition, sleep, exercise), care techniques, ethics, communication, and medical safety. The second, care competency across the lifespan, consists of 31 items addressing care from pregnancy through aging and death, with domains like sexuality and life, family, children, adults, older adults, and advanced care planning. The third theme, care competency by stages of illness, has 18 items focusing on disease progression from onset to terminal phase, including mental healthcare and acute, recovery, chronic, and end-of-life care. Lastly, care competency through living in the community comprises 26 items related to social resources and systems, including support from schools and agencies, as well as disaster preparedness and care during emergencies.
4. Discussion
The aim of this study was to define the care competencies required for community citizens and clarify their components based on expert consensus using the Delphi method. This process resulted in a comprehensive list of 151 competency items, which were organized into four categories as follows: foundations of care competency, care competency across the lifespan, care competency by stages of illness, and care competency through community living. This framework provides a robust theoretical basis for developing citizen-oriented educational programs aimed at enhancing community members’ abilities to provide and receive care, thereby fostering a community-based, inclusive society []. Given the global challenge of rapidly aging societies, Japan, which is developing universal frameworks such as care competency, holds significant implications for global community health policy [,].
4.1. Concept Distinction and Boundaries
We defined “care competency” as the complex ability to acquire and utilize knowledge and skills, based on evidence and intentional choices, to maintain the well-being of oneself, loved ones, and people in the community. This concept explicitly integrates knowledge, skills, and attitudes, justifying its creation as a necessary framework for community-level care by non-professionals. Existing frameworks, such as health literacy [,,] and community literacy [], primarily focus on understanding and utilizing health-related information. However, these concepts, stemming from the literal meaning of “literacy,” lack the practical dimensions of caregiving, such as empathic attitudes, role readiness, and contextual decision-making, which are crucial for non-professionals. Care competency fills this critical gap by integrating the essential knowledge, skills, and attitudes required for active participation in caregiving.
The consensus process, especially the panel meeting discussions, provided valuable insight into the boundaries between professional and non-professional expectations. During the first evaluation, complex items, such as the “ability to judge the effects and side effects of treatments such as pharmacotherapy,” were frequently rated lower. Panelists commented that verbs such as “judge” might be beyond the ability expected of non-professionals, indicating that the ability to judge is quite advanced. The subsequent removal of such complex items and revision of language to focus on content clarified that care competency centers on foundational knowledge and practical support, rather than diagnostic or clinical judgment. This distinction is critical for defining appropriate roles for citizens in community care.
4.2. Strengths and Practical Application
The comprehensive list of 151 items, developed by adapting the rigorous Model Core Curriculum for Nursing Education in Japan [], represents a pioneering effort to define generalizable care competencies beyond disease- or target-specific training programs. This framework provides a robust theoretical basis that can be leveraged to create educational programs.
However, we should address the practicality and feasibility of implementation given the volume and scope of the 151 items, and the fact that the target population is “all citizens.” A uniform program structure is unlikely to be realistic due to varying learning burdens, motivation, and life needs. Therefore, future implementation should adopt a flexible, modular, and phased educational approach. Examples of practical delivery formats include online learning, community-based workshops, microlearning resources, and e-learning. Implementation should also be integrated into existing societal structures using concrete examples, such as incorporating these competencies into school curricula, community volunteer programs, local emergency management training, or introductory modules focusing on concrete life challenges, including caring for older adults, parenting, or disaster response. This approach is expected to support the practical application of the work and encourage engagement from key stakeholders, including local governments, educators, and non-profit organizations.
4.3. Comparison with International Initiatives
The Social Determinants of Health (SDoH)—non-medical factors such as sociocultural, political, and economic environments—are widely recognized as fundamental drivers of health disparities [,]. Addressing these systemic inequities requires a comprehensive approach that extends beyond clinical care and engages broader social structures. The Care Competency Framework proposed in this study responds to this imperative by integrating both practical and systemic knowledge essential for navigating health-related challenges. In particular, the theme of “care competency through living in the community” highlights the importance of utilizing social resources, including welfare and social security systems, to empower individuals in overcoming barriers to care and promoting health equity. By positioning care as a shared civic responsibility, the framework aligns with global efforts to address SDoH through inclusive, community-based strategies.
Compared to existing international initiatives, the Care Competency Framework offers a distinct and more universal orientation. Programs such as the Community Health Worker education initiatives in the United States [,,] and the Health (Community) Champions in the United Kingdom [,] train selected individuals—typically without formal medical qualifications—to provide basic health support and promote health awareness within their communities. While these models have demonstrated effectiveness in reaching underserved populations and fostering trust, they remain limited by role specificity, sustainability challenges, and uneven implementation. In contrast, the Care Competency Framework defines essential care-related skills for all citizens across the lifespan, encompassing both caregiving and care-receiving roles. This universality enables the development of tailored programs that reflect diverse life stages and social contexts. By offering a scalable and adaptable model, the framework helps to democratize care. It supports the advancement of inclusive, equity-oriented practices responsive to local and global SDoH conditions.
4.4. Limitations and Future Research Directions
Despite these strengths, our study has some limitations. First, regarding the panel composition, the care competencies were developed exclusively by a relatively small and homogeneous group of 10 nursing researchers, meaning the final competency list may reflect the priorities of this specific discipline. Although all panelists held registered nurse qualifications and had prior working experience in clinical or administrative settings, we did not detail the extent of their current clinical experience and engagement in frontline community-based practice.
Second, the practical applicability and feasibility of these 151 competencies for citizens is yet to be validated. Therefore, future studies should involve diverse stakeholders, including multidisciplinary practitioners, frontline professionals (e.g., visiting nurses, staff from community comprehensive support centers, or municipal health officials), informal caregivers, and community residents. Incorporating feedback from professionals who work directly with community members is essential to enhance the practical applicability and feasibility of implementation. Third, the large number of care competency items is a limitation. Statistical methods such as factor analysis could be beneficial to enhance the efficiency and practicality of the final list.
Finally, this study focused solely on clarifying the concept and creating the list. Future research should focus on the empirical validation of this framework with citizens and informal caregivers (including individuals with caregiving experience). In addition, this framework’s applicability should be tested in different cultural contexts beyond Japan to confirm its global relevance. Future steps include developing scales to measure care competency cultivation and the learning effects of educational programs. Moreover, continuous implementation, participant feedback, and improvement are necessary to ensure the list remains comprehensive and relevant.
5. Conclusions
This study defined care competency and established a comprehensive 151-item framework for community citizens. Notably, this novel framework provides a practical basis for developing globally applicable educational programs for rapidly aging societies. Aimed at non-professionals, the categorized competencies can transform existing fragmented training into tailored, comprehensive community care education. Future research, including validation with diverse stakeholders and developing measurement scales, is essential to refine the model’s practical applicability.
